About

The Health Outreach for Youth and Adults (HOYA) Clinic is managed by students of the Georgetown University School of Medicine with direct oversight from MedStar Georgetown University Hospital faculty and professional administration. The clinic seeks to decrease health disparities and improve health equity by providing care to DC's under-served families. HOYA Clinic recently opened the doors of its new location at the Triumph, a Community of Hope temporary housing facility in Southeast Washington.

This year we are again raising funds to purchase gifts from wish lists collected directly from the children we serve. Our goal this holiday season is to touch as many hearts as we can by purchasing at least one toy from each child’s list. The only way this is possible is through your generous support.

All donations will be used to purchase toys from the children's wish lists. On December 4th, medical student volunteers will host a day of arts, crafts, and other activities and present each child with their wrapped, personalized gift.
